Output 51c7626a842a9869b0c4f40864f96f628fc755a98302c85e395fcd1fcf3ffd03:4

value
405335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 007db8dba26d385f9dfa4b1c7f4a1b28bc9e0ef5 OP_EQUAL
address
31jcXsKsm2ABkSaokr6ioQxNBdXNo6QzwT
transaction
51c7626a842a9869b0c4f40864f96f628fc755a98302c85e395fcd1fcf3ffd03